Biden denounces 'Republican extremists' as he signs executive order on abortion access

WASHINGTON — Vowing to continue the fight against last month’s Supreme Court overruling of the 1973 decision in Roe v. Wade that made abortion legal nationwide, President Biden signed an executive order on Friday that would push back against Republican efforts to limit reproductive choice.

He also denounced who he described as ‘Republican extremists’ who want not only to restrict abortion in individual states but enact a nationwide abortion ban. “This is not some imagined horror, it’s already happening,” Biden said from the White House.

He was flanked by Vice President Kamala Harris and Health and Human Services Secretary Xavier Becerra, both of whom have, like him, condemned last month’s decision in Dobbs v. Jackson Women's Health Organization, which returned the power to regulate abortion entirely to states.

“This was not a decision driven by the constitution," an impassioned Biden said, depicting the conservative majority’s decision in Dobbs as “an exercise of raw political power."
